The formula for the surface area of a sphere is A=4pi r*2, where r is the length of the radius. Find the surface area of the sph

ere with a radius of 14. Use 22/7 as pi
Mathematics
1 answer:
g100num [7]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

area=4×22/7×14²=4×22×28=2464 units²

The sum of the first three terms of a sequence is 6 and the fourth term is 16
Sati [7]

Answer:

              a₁ = -5, d = 7,  a₂ = 2, a₃ = 9, a₄ = 16

equation of sequence:    \boxed{\bold{a_n=7n-12}}

Step-by-step explanation:

a₁ + a₂ + a₃ = 6    

a₁ + a₁ + d + a₁ + 2d = 6

3a₁ + 3d = 6

a₁ + d= 2     ⇒ a₁ = 2 - d

a₄ = 16

a₁ + 3d = 16

2 - r + 3d = 16

2d = 14

d = 7

a₁ = 2-7 = -5

a₁ = -5, d = 7   ⇒  a₂ = -5+7 = 2, a₃ = 2+7 = 9, a₄ = 9+7 = 16

equation of arithmetic sequence:

a_n=a_1+d(n-1)\\\\a_n=-5+7(n-1)\\\\\underline{a_n=7n-12}

All the pictures are in order for every question
ivanzaharov [21]

Answer:

  1. C.) obtuse triangle
  2. 39°
  3. 167°
  4. D.) 111°

Step-by-step explanation:

1. The sum of angles in a triangle is 180°. The sum of the given angles is less than 90°, so the remaining angle must be more than 90°. When the largest angle is more than 90°, it is an obtuse angle. A triangle with an obtuse angle is classified as obtuse.

__

2. The sum of the interior angles is 180°, so we have ...

  x° +39° +102° = 180°

  x° = 39° . . . . . . . . . . . subtract 141°

__

3. The third interior angle is the supplement to the sum of the given interior angles. Likewise, x° is the supplement to the third interior angle, so its value is the same as the sum of the two given interior angles. (The rule is often stated as "an exterior angle is equal to the sum of the remote interior angles.")

  x° = 130° +37°

  x° = 167°

__

4. Same deal as problem 3:

  x° = 75° +36°

  x° = 111°
